The Prince of Wales at Biarritz
The Prince of Wales (later King Edward VIII, Duke of Windsor), travelling as the Earl of Chester, pictured in Biarritz in April 1926. A favourite resort of the Prince, he was recuperating from an ear operation and is accompanied here by General Trotter. Date: 1926
